I wish to show that The Web can be more private, secure, accessable, and easier
to author if it limited it's scope and drastically simplified. I do not aim to
support highly-interactive "webapps", but rather keep the I/O model abstract
enough that it can work pretty much anywhere.

As such I'm implementing my own browser engines, and making them modular enough
that you can reuse it's components in other browser engines or other projects.
